Repeat Offender Arrested Near Casablanca with 480 kg of Cannabis Resin

A repeat offender who was the subject of a national arrest warrant was apprehended on Friday evening by the prefectural judicial police service of Casablanca, thanks to information provided by the services of the General Directorate of Territorial Surveillance (DGST).
The 52-year-old suspect is said to be involved in a case of possession and trafficking of drugs and narcotics, according to a statement from the General Directorate of National Security (DGSN).
The search of the suspect’s vehicle led to his apprehension in the rural area of Sidi Rahhal, near Casablanca, and the seizure of 480 kilograms of cannabis resin, the statement said.
In order to determine the ins and outs of this case and shed light on all the offenses attributed to the accused, the latter was placed in custody, at the disposal of the investigation conducted under the supervision of the competent public prosecutor’s office.
